[RISCV] Support `llvm.masked.compressstore` intrinsic (#83457)

The changeset enables lowering of `llvm.masked.compressstore(%data,
%ptr, %mask)` for RVV for fixed vector type into:
```
%0 = vcompress %data, %mask, %vl
%new_vl = vcpop %mask, %vl
vse %0, %ptr, %1, %new_vl
```
Such lowering is only possible when `%data` fits into available LMULs
and otherwise `llvm.masked.compressstore` is scalarized by
`ScalarizeMaskedMemIntrin` pass.
Even though RVV spec in the section `15.8` provide alternative sequence
for compressstore, use of `vcompress + vcpop` should be a proper
canonical form to lower `llvm.masked.compressstore`. If RISC-V target
find the sequence from `15.8` better, peephole optimization can
transform `vcompress + vcpop` into that sequence.
